FAQs

When to pump? Most homes need pumping every 3 years, but appliance load and tank size change the schedule. We measure sludge to set a custom timeline.

Red flags? Slow drains, standing water, and alarm beeps all signal service time.

Tank finding? We use as-builts to mark your tank and record locations for the next visit.

Homeowner Checklist

Week to week, use this practical checklist to keep your Ogden, Utah septic system steady: space laundry loads, scrape plates, avoid wipes, listen for gurgles, and look for lush stripes. If anything feels off, get in touch before minimal signs become messy problems.

Seasonally, glance at alarms, wipe effluent filters if accessible, and ensure downspouts pull water from the field. Keep records so future service stays smoother. We can email a custom checklist for your household on request.

Ogden /ˈɒɡdən/ (Shoshone: Ho-quip) is a city in and the county seat of Weber County, Utah, United States, approximately 10 miles (16 km) east of the Great Salt Lake and 40 miles (64 km) north of Salt Lake City. The population was 87,321 in 2020, according to the US Census Bureau, making it Utah's eighth largest city. The city served as a major railway hub through much of its history, and still handles a great deal of freight rail traffic which makes it a convenient location for manufacturing and commerce. Ogden is also known for its many historic buildings, proximity to the Wasatch Mountains, and as the location of Weber State University.
